The Start of Something Spicy: Prepping Your Ingredients

Making a delicious green chili soup starts with good preparation. You'll need to gather your ingredients and chop them up into small pieces. Begin by chopping up a yellow onion, slicing garlic cloves into thin pieces, and dicing up green chilies. To save time, you can purchase canned green chilies or roast your own. If you decide to roast your own, be sure to remove the skin and seeds before dicing.

Spice it Up: The Importance of Choosing the Right Green Chilies

Choosing the right green chilies is crucial to the success of your soup. You can use mild or spicy chilies depending on your preference. Hatch chilies are a popular choice for this soup and come in different heat levels. If you prefer a milder soup, opt for Anaheim chilies. For a spicier soup, choose serrano or jalapeno chilies. Be sure to taste the chilies before adding them to the soup to ensure the heat level is to your liking.

Sautéing for Flavor: Preparing Your Onions and Garlic

To add depth of flavor to your soup, sauté the onions and garlic in olive oil until they are translucent. This step will help to release their natural sweetness and aromas. Be careful not to burn the garlic, as it can become bitter. Sautéing the onions and garlic also helps to soften them, which will make for a smoother puree.

Blending the Perfect Base: Pureeing Your Tomatoes

A smooth and creamy base is important for a delicious soup. To achieve this, puree canned tomatoes in a blender until they are smooth. If you prefer a chunkier soup, you can skip this step. Adding the tomato puree to the sautéed onions and garlic will create a flavorful base for the soup.

Building Layers of Flavor: Adding Chicken Broth and Spices

Once you have your base, it's time to add some depth by incorporating chicken broth and spices. Pour in chicken broth and stir until well combined. Then, add in cumin, oregano, and salt to taste. These spices will complement the flavors of the green chilies and create a well-rounded soup. Bring the soup to a boil and then reduce the heat to a simmer.

Time to Heat Things Up: Simmering and Reducing the Soup

Simmering the soup for about 20 minutes will allow the flavors to meld together. It's important to keep an eye on the soup and stir occasionally to prevent burning. If the soup is too thick, you can add more chicken broth to thin it out. If the soup is too thin, allow it to simmer longer to reduce and thicken.

The Creamy Finishing Touch: Adding the Heavy Cream

To add a creamy texture and richness to your soup, stir in heavy cream. This step is optional, but it adds a decadent touch to the soup. Be sure to stir the soup continuously as you add the heavy cream to prevent curdling. Allow the soup to simmer for a few more minutes to fully incorporate the cream.

Garnishing Your Soup: Cilantro, Sour Cream, and Crisp Tortilla Strips

Garnishing your soup with cilantro, sour cream, and crisp tortilla strips will add texture and flavor. Chop fresh cilantro and sprinkle it on top of the soup. Add a dollop of sour cream to each bowl and top with crispy tortilla strips. You can also add shredded cheese or diced avocado for additional toppings.

Making It Your Own: Variation Ideas for Green Chili Soup

There are endless variations you can try with green chili soup. You can add in cooked chicken or ground beef for a heartier soup. For a vegetarian option, use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th and omit the meat. You can also add in corn or black beans for added texture and flavor.

Soup’s On! Serving Up a Delicious Bowl of Green Chili Soup

Serve your green chili soup hot with your favorite toppings and sides. A slice of crusty bread or a side salad pairs well with this soup.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to four days or frozen for later use. Enjoy the spicy and flavorful goodness of this delicious soup!

Ingredients:

  • 1 pound fresh green chilies
  • 4 cloves garlic, chopped
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Cut the green chilies into small pieces and remove the seeds.
  2. Melt the butter in a pot over medium heat.
  3. Add the chopped onions and garlic to the pot and sauté until they become translucent.
  4. Add the green chilies to the pot and cook for 5 minutes.
  5.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a boil.
  6. Reduce the heat and let the soup simmer for 10-15 minutes.
  7. Remove the pot from the heat and let it cool slightly.
  8. Use an immersion blender to puree the soup until it is smooth.
  9. Add the heavy cream to the pot and stir well.
  10. Season the soup with salt and pepper to taste.
  11. Serve hot and enjoy!

Many people are curious about the Green Chili Soup Recipe and have a lot of questions about it. Here are some common questions and their answers:

  • What are the ingredients needed for Green Chili Soup?

    The ingredients required for Green Chili Soup Recipe are green chilies, chicken broth, onions, garlic, salt, black pepper, cilantro, and lime juice.

  • Is Green Chili Soup Recipe spicy?

    Yes, Green Chili Soup Recipe is spicy because it uses green chilies as the main ingredient. However, you can adjust the spice level by adding or reducing the amount of green chilies used.

  • Can I use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th in Green Chili Soup Recipe?

    Yes, you can use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th in Green Chili Soup Recipe to make it vegetarian-friendly.

  • What can I serve with Green Chili Soup Recipe?

    You can serve Green Chili Soup Recipe with tortilla chips, sour cream, shredded cheese, avocado slices, or crusty bread.

  • How long does Green Chili Soup Recipe last in the fridge?

    Green Chili Soup Recipe can last up to 4 days in the fridge if stored properly in an airtight container.
